Veesommai, Uamporn - Abstract:
- The Rice Production Ontology (RPO) was constructed from scratch in consultation with domain-experts. This ontology covers the domain of rice production from cultivation to harvesting. Refinement in the loop was done by performing the transformation following the criteria validated by expert to improve the created ontology. The RPO contains 2322 concepts and 5603 terms in a system of hierarchical and 57 associative relations and provides an organisational framework that allows reasoning about rice production knowledge. From the study, eight criteria for constructing ontology and five rules for the semi-automatic maintenance were derived.
